Carter's,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, designs, sources, and markets branded childrenswear in the United States and internationally.
Carter's, Inc. in the Consumer Cyclical sector is trading at $38.75 with a market capitalization of $1.6B. Wall Street consensus targets $42.67 (6 analysts), implying a +10.1% move over the next 12 months. The stock is currently 13% below its 52-week high of $44.44, remaining 10.2% above its 200-day moving average. On fundamentals, Piotroski 5/9 shows mixed financial quality.
